c 课设制作计算器

“c 课设制作计算器”相关的资料有哪些?“c 课设制作计算器”相关的范文有哪些?怎么写?下面是小编为您精心整理的“c 课设制作计算器”相关范文大全或资料大全,欢迎大家分享。

C程序项目一制作简单计算器

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

项目一—简单计算器制作

项目演示

课程项目展示

目标 理解和掌握项目所涉及的知识点 掌握C语言的基本编程方法 学会使用菜单解决日常生活中的小问题

相关知识点序号1 2 3

知识点

说明

常用数据类型:整型、浮点型、字符型 定义符号:int、float、double、char 常量、变量 (1)双目算术运算符及其表达式: 运算符: +、 -、*、 /、 % (2)强制类型转换: (类型)表达式 数据的输入输出: 变量名命名、变量类型的选择

%:整数取余 /、%:除数不为0控制符的使用:%d、%f、%c

4

scanf() 、printf() getchar()、putchar()5 6 7 多分支选择语句:

函数原型:stdio.h 注意函数的返回值switch表达式的类型:整型、字符型 无限循环的设定 函数原型:stdlib.h

if-elseif、switch循环语句:while、do-while、for 清屏函数:system(“cls”) 结束程序函数:exit(0)

功能描述 功能:实现一个简易计算器,能够完成数值型数据的加、减、乘、 除、求余运算。

要求: 采用人机对话形式:使用菜单 通过多分支选择语句实现加、减、乘、除、求余运算 添加必要的提

C程序项目一制作简单计算器

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

项目一—简单计算器制作

项目演示

课程项目展示

目标 理解和掌握项目所涉及的知识点 掌握C语言的基本编程方法 学会使用菜单解决日常生活中的小问题

相关知识点序号1 2 3

知识点

说明

常用数据类型:整型、浮点型、字符型 定义符号:int、float、double、char 常量、变量 (1)双目算术运算符及其表达式: 运算符: +、 -、*、 /、 % (2)强制类型转换: (类型)表达式 数据的输入输出: 变量名命名、变量类型的选择

%:整数取余 /、%:除数不为0控制符的使用:%d、%f、%c

4

scanf() 、printf() getchar()、putchar()5 6 7 多分支选择语句:

函数原型:stdio.h 注意函数的返回值switch表达式的类型:整型、字符型 无限循环的设定 函数原型:stdlib.h

if-elseif、switch循环语句:while、do-while、for 清屏函数:system(“cls”) 结束程序函数:exit(0)

功能描述 功能:实现一个简易计算器,能够完成数值型数据的加、减、乘、 除、求余运算。

要求: 采用人机对话形式:使用菜单 通过多分支选择语句实现加、减、乘、除、求余运算 添加必要的提

javascript制作计算器源代码

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

计算器

QQ:826219395

用MFC制作简易计算器

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

用VC++制作简单计算器

简述:该课程设计将实现一个简单计算器。其类似于Windows附件中自带的计算器。这个计算器可以实现简单的四则运算功能,而且具有简洁大方的图文外观。系统具有良好的界面和必要的交互信息。即时准确地获得需要的计算的结果,充分降低了数字计算的难度,从而节约了时间,对人们的生活有一定的帮助。在课程设计中,程序设计设计语言采用Visual C++,在程序设计中,采用了面向对象解决问题的方法。

课题背景

计算器是日常生活中十分便捷有效的工具,能实现加、减、乘、除简单运算的工具。要实现计算功能,可以用VC++的知识编写程序来解决此问题。该计算器大大的降低了数字计算的难度及提高了计算的准确度和精确度。该计算器使用非常简单和方便,对广大中小学生的学习有巨大帮助作用,也对在职人员的工作有点帮助作用。

功能说明

系统具有良好的界面;必要的交互信息;简约美观的效果。使用人员能快捷简单地进行操作。可单机按钮进行操作即时准确地获得需要的计算的结果,充分降低了数字计算的难度和节约了时间,对人们的生活有一定的帮助。

(1)包含的功能有:加、减、乘、除;

(2)计算器上数字分为显示区,可以显示用户所点击的按键,最后显示结果;按键区,可以让用户选择所需的

AVR单片机制作计算器

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

包括Proteus模拟电路图C语言程序

Proteus中的模拟电路:

C语言程序:

#include<mega32.h>

#include<delay.h>

unsigned int put[] = {0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f}; unsigned int key;

unsigned int led_1,led_2,led_3,led_4,fuhao,num,num_1;

interrupt [EXT_INT0]void ext_int0_isr() //按键中断 低电平触发 {

PORTD.4=0;

PORTA = 0x01;

if(PINA.4) key = 16; // 清零

if(PINA.5) key = 3;

if(PINA.6) key = 2;

if(PINA.7) key = 1;

PORTA = 0x02;

if(PINA.4) key = 15; // 等于

包括Proteus模拟电路图C语言程序

if(PINA.5) key = 6;

if(PINA.6) key = 5;

if(PINA.7) key = 4;

PORTA = 0x04

C++计算器课程设计

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

C++课程设计报告

( 2013 — 2014 年度第 1 学期)

计算器程序设计

专 业 学生姓名 班 级 学 号 指导教师 完成日期

计算机科学与技术

2014年1月16日

C++课程设计

目 录

摘 要 ....................................................................................................................... 1 1、引 言 ................................................................................................................... 1

1.1 课题意义及目的 .................................................................................................................. 1 1.2 课程设计内容及要求 .......................

C++课程设计 - 计算器

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

面向对象程序设计语言 --课程设计

题 目 计算器设计

院 系 航空宇航学院

专 业 飞行器设计与工程 学生姓名 张权 学 号 011110320 指导教师 张德平

二零一二 年 六 月 九 日

课程设计报告

计算器设计

(一)、目的与要求:

1、目的:

通过开发计算器程序,进一步熟悉C++中类和对象的定义与使用,掌握程序控制的方法,掌握C++程序设计的基本知识。 2、基本要求:

(1)设计计算器程序,可对实数操作; (2)可对多个基数操作的四则运算;

(3)增加函数如:正弦、余弦、正切、对数、平方和平方根、完成四则混合运算,注意考虑优先级,对应增加主菜单选项;

(4)根据程序的提示,可以进行正弦运算进行余弦运算、正切运算、对数运算、求平方运算、混合运算、华氏温度转化为摄氏温度的运算、摄氏温度转化为华氏温度的运算、求

C语言实现计算器功能

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

实验一多功能计算器

一、问题描述

设计一个多功能计算器,可以完成基本的计算。

设计要求:

1. 具备整型数据、浮点型数据的算术(加、减、乘、除)运算功能。依次输入第一个运算数、运算符(+,- ,* ,/ )、第二个运算数,然后输出结果。结果可以作为下一个运算的第一运算数。按’C清

屏,按’R'返回菜单。

例如:输入:2

+

5

输出:7

2. 实现单运算符表达式计算的功能。输入的操作数可以包含整数或浮点数。输入表达式如下:

例如:输入:2+5

输出:7

二、算法说明

1.数据结构说明(可以图示说明,也可以文字说明)

本程序主要根据选择菜单编写了六个自定义函数,用于在main()函数中调用,在main()中,用一个字符变量num1 来记录下菜单选项的标号,根据num1 的值来决定调用哪个函数。

程序要完成的功能及所要用到的函数如下:

使用各菜单分别调用的函数 '≡ua∩ Ξ huyun≡u an O ■> SUanShUyUnSLLan2 panduan() > bi aodashiyunsuan 0 > QirLgPing () > fanhuicaidan()

菜 I Y l - ▽ 算术运算

a 卑运篡符表达

b 清屏

C 返回菜单

E 退岀程序 t

F 面是整个程

c++大作业--计算器类

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

面向对象程序设计大作业

------计算器类

学 院 名 称 信息科学与工程学院 专业班级 学生姓名 学 号 指 导 教 师

完成时间:2013 年 05 月 26 日

计算器类

1. 编程目的

巩固了所学《C++语言程序设计》的基本理论知识,理论联系实际,进一步培养自己综合分析问题和解决问题的能力;掌握运用C++语言独立地编写、调试应用程序和进行其它相关设计的技能。 2. 系统简介

此计算器的编写应用了类的实现,函数的调用以及类的封装等C++中的基本知识;基本上实现了加减乘除运算,三角函数运算,开平方运算,各种进制之间的转换等;此计算器使用简洁,易于操作。 3. 编程思路

(1)因为要实现计算器的相关功能,而且要求计算加减乘除平方基本运算,二进制,十进制,八进制,十六进制之间的转换,三角函的计算,所以要根据情况依次设计;

(2)三角函数运算,因为在库函数中就有三角函数,所以可以直接使用,只不过参数是以弧度制传入的,所以

C#计算器程序设计

标签:文库时间:2025-01-06
【bwwdw.com - 博文网】

C#计算器程序设计

1)创建项目

①单击文件-》新建-》项目,弹出如下对话框

②模板中选择“windows窗体应用程序”-》名称中输入“jsq”-》位置单击“留了”-》选择“J:\\新建文件夹”-》单击确定按钮

2)计算器界面设计

①向Form1中添加1个TextBox控件,1个Label控件和27个Button控件,控件布局如图所示

②修改27个Button控件的Text属性,结果如图

③Label控件的BorderStyle属性选择“Fixed3D”-》Text属性设置为“ ”-》Form1的Text属性设置为“计算器”-》Backspace控件、CE控件等的ForeColor属性选择“Red”,结果如图:

3)显示窗口数据对齐方式设置

TextBox控件的TextAlign属性选择“Right”; 4)数字键程序设计

①双击”0”按钮控件-》编写代码如下:

if (textBox1.Text != \不能连续多个0出现 {

textBox1.Text += \添加“0”数字 }

②双击”1”按钮控件-》编写代码如下:

if (textBo